Amazon Pulls 5,000 IPG E-Books over New Terms

Amazon has taken almost 5,000 Kindle e-books from distributor Independent Publishers Group (IPG) off its web store after a disagreement between the two on renewal terms. IPG wouldn’t agree to Amazon’s new terms, and was warned of the consequences, IPG President Mark Suchomel told PaidContent. The distributor’s offer to Amazon is the same it has […]

Amazon Kindle Sales Jump 4X Year Over Year

Amazon on Monday claimed that its Kindle sales on Black Friday were much higher than last year. The combination of the $79 Kindle, Kindle Touch, and Kindle Fire moved four times as many units as the same day last year. The Fire was the top seller, having kept the lead on Amazon’s charts for the […]

Amazon Kindle 3.3 Update Brings Cloud to Older Kindles

Amazon has posted a 3.3 update to give owners of the (third-generation Kindle) some of the features of newer models. The update gives the same Kindle Cloud access as available on the Kindle Touch and fourth-generation Kindle. Its addition lets the e-reader store personal documents online for access on most Kindle devices, not just downloaded […]

New Kindle Owners Can Pay $30 to Remove Ads

The newly introduced, ad-supported Kindles can get their ads removed, though Amazon will charge users $30 to do it, per a user on the MobileRead forums. The company allows owners of the Special Offers Kindle to log into their Manage Your Kindle page and unsubscribe from the ads. This costs the difference in the retail […]
